    The Origins of Auntie Anne's

    When was Auntie Anne's created? The journey began in 1988 in the heart of Pennsylvania, a state renowned for its love of pretzels. Anne Beiler, the founder of Auntie Anne's, started selling pretzels at a local farmers' market in Downingtown, Pennsylvania. Her passion for baking and her unique recipe quickly gained attention, leading to the establishment of the first Auntie Anne's store.

    The name "Auntie Anne's" was chosen to honor Anne Beiler's maiden name, Anne Hostetter. The name not only reflects the personal touch of the founder but also evokes a sense of warmth and familiarity that resonates with customers. From its humble beginnings, Auntie Anne's has grown into a global brand, but the core values of quality, freshness, and customer satisfaction remain unchanged.

    Why Pennsylvania?

    Pennsylvania has a rich history of pretzel-making, dating back to the early days of German settlers in the region. This cultural heritage provided the perfect backdrop for Anne Beiler's entrepreneurial venture. The local community's appreciation for pretzels made it an ideal location to test and refine her recipe.

    The Founders Behind Auntie Anne's

    Anne Beiler, the woman behind Auntie Anne's, had a vision to create a pretzel that stood out from the rest. Her journey began with a passion for baking and a desire to share her creations with others. Together with her husband, Jonas Beiler, they worked tirelessly to bring Auntie Anne's to life.

    Jonas played a crucial role in the business, handling the operational aspects while Anne focused on the recipe and customer experience. Their partnership was instrumental in the early success of Auntie Anne's and laid the foundation for its future growth.

    The First Auntie Anne's Store

    The first Auntie Anne's store opened its doors in 1988 at the Downingtown Farmers Market in Pennsylvania. This location served as the testing ground for Anne's unique pretzel recipe and her customer-centric approach. The store's success was a testament to the quality of the product and the warmth of the service.

    Expansion and Growth

    After the success of the first store, Auntie Anne's began expanding its operations. The brand's focus on quality and customer satisfaction made it an attractive option for mall operators and franchisees. By the early 1990s, Auntie Anne's had established itself as a staple in shopping malls across the United States.

    The expansion strategy was carefully planned, with an emphasis on maintaining the brand's core values. Auntie Anne's invested in training programs to ensure that every location delivered the same level of quality and service. This approach paid off, as the brand continued to grow at a steady pace.

    Franchising and Global Reach

    In 1998, Auntie Anne's made the decision to franchise its operations, allowing entrepreneurs around the world to become part of the brand. This move significantly accelerated the brand's growth and led to its expansion into international markets.

    Today, Auntie Anne's has over 1,300 locations in more than 30 countries. The brand's global presence is a testament to its ability to adapt to different cultures while maintaining its core identity. From the United States to Asia, Auntie Anne's continues to delight customers with its signature pretzels.
